Transaction 42518d5d3d82de37a557397e88b7623b8617839734e5fc2d8bdeb37054c69480
1 Input
1 Output
-
42518d5d3d82de37a557397e88b7623b8617839734e5fc2d8bdeb37054c69480:0
- value
- 643688
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f0accfacd0f1081a6ee31b028e353df99e13172
- address
- tb1q8u9ve7kdpuggrfhwxxcz3c6nm7v7zvtj9zunyk